From 0cb0f91e43abe49ea6b7baa29c0bc5f5644eee7f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jared Vititoe Date: Sun, 13 Sep 2026 00:56:23 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] =?UTF-8?q?test(e2e):=20Playwright=20smoke=20test=20?= =?UTF-8?q?=E2=80=94=20boot=20tier=20always,=20E2EE=20composer=20tier=20wi?= =?UTF-8?q?th=20credentials?= M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Boot tier (runs against vite preview of dist/): login screen renders with no page or console errors, sw.js is served and registers, the bundled Element Call mounts in a frame with no failed asset requests. E2EE tier (skipped without E2E_HOMESERVER/E2E_USER/E2E_PASSWORD): password login, create an encrypted room, send text, attach a compressed JPEG, and assert at the network level that every send is m.room.encrypted with no plaintext body/url/file — the regression test #6/#7/#11 lacked. Secrets and local usage documented in LOTUS_TESTING.md.
